Are You Making These AI Data Analysis Mistakes That Will COST You Your Job?

In today's data-driven world, AI and machine learning have revolutionized the way we handle data analysis. However, just like any powerful tool, the misuse of AI can lead to significant mistakes that could jeopardize your career. Here are some common pitfalls in AI data analysis that you need to be aware of to safeguard your professional future.

1. Neglecting Data Quality

Problem: Poor quality data can result in misleading insights, leading to faulty decision-making. Many analysts may overlook the importance of cleaning and preprocessing data, assuming that the AI will compensate for any deficiencies.

Solution: Always prioritize data quality. Implement robust data cleaning processes to remove duplicates, handle missing values, and standardize formats. Before feeding data into AI algorithms, confirm that it is accurate and representative of the business context.

2. Ignoring Bias in Data

Problem: AI algorithms can perpetuate and even amplify biases present in the training data. Failing to recognize and mitigate bias can lead to unfair or discriminatory outcomes, which can damage your organization’s reputation and lead to legal trouble.

Solution: Conduct thorough bias assessments of your datasets. Utilize techniques such as fairness metrics and ensure diversity in your training data. Regularly audit your models to identify and address any bias that arises.

3. Over-relying on Automated Tools

Problem: While AI tools can automate many aspects of data analysis, an over-reliance on these tools can lead to complacency. Analysts may ignore the need for critical thinking and contextual understanding, letting the technology dictate their findings.

Solution: Use AI tools as assistants, not replacements. Always validate and interpret the results with your domain expertise. Contextualize the output to ensure that it aligns with business objectives and existing knowledge.

4. Failing to Communicate Insights Effectively

Problem: Even if you discover valuable insights, failing to communicate them clearly and effectively can render your analysis useless. Complex technical jargon and poorly designed visualizations may confuse stakeholders, leading to a lack of action.

Solution: Focus on storytelling with data. Tailor your presentations to your audience, using clear visuals and straightforward explanations to convey your insights effectively. Keep your analysis actionable and highlight the business implications of your findings.

5. Ignoring Model Validation

Problem: Many analysts neglect to validate their AI models after deployment, assuming that initial training performance guarantees success in real-world applications. This can lead to models performing poorly in production.

Solution: Establish a rigorous validation framework. Continuously monitor model performance against new data and adjust as necessary. Conduct A/B testing to evaluate the effectiveness of your models in achieving desired outcomes.

6. Underestimating Privacy and Compliance Issues

Problem: With increasing regulations around data privacy, failing to consider compliance can lead to severe consequences. Analysts may inadvertently use personal data without proper consent, exposing their organizations to legal risks.

Solution: Familiarize yourself with data privacy laws relevant to your industry, such as GDPR or CCPA. Implement strict data governance practices to ensure compliance and protect sensitive information.

7. Neglecting Collaboration

Problem: Data analysis shouldn't be a solitary endeavor. Failing to collaborate with other departments can lead to a lack of alignment and missed opportunities for insight extraction.

Solution: Foster a collaborative environment by engaging with cross-functional teams. Solicit feedback and share your findings to create a more holistic understanding of the data and enhance decision-making across the organization.

Conclusion

Making mistakes in AI data analysis can have serious repercussions for your career. By being vigilant about data quality, bias, communication, model validation, compliance, and collaboration, you can position yourself as a valuable asset within your organization. Embrace these practices to reduce the risk of costly errors and improve the impact of your data analysis efforts. Remember, in the world of AI and data analysis, your expertise and discernment are as crucial as the tools you use. Stay informed and proactive to secure your place in this evolving field.
